Introduction

XAT 2025 XAT 2025 is scheduled for Sunday, January 05, 2025. Conducted by XLRI on behalf of XAMI, the XAT exam has been a benchmark in selecting the most qualified candidates for management education for over 75 years. As one of the oldest and most prestigious competitive exams in India, XAT continually evolves to incorporate the latest advancements in testing methodologies. Its comprehensive, multidimensional assessment framework is meticulously designed to evaluate candidatesโ€™ aptitude for success in business leadership. The XAT score is recognized by over 250 institutes across the country for their admission processes.

Photograph Image

  • The photograph must be a recent passport-size color picture.
  • The           picture           should           have   a      light-colored background, preferably white.
  • Look straight at the camera with a relaxed face.
  • If the picture is taken outdoors, ensure the sun is behind you or stand in the shade to avoid squinting or harsh shadows.
  • If using flash, make sure thereโ€™s no red-eye.
  • If you wear glasses, ensure there are no reflections and your eyes are clearly visible.
  • Caps, hats, and dark glasses are not allowed. Religious headwear is permitted, but it must not cover your face.
  • Preferred dimensions: 200 x 230 pixels.
  • File size should be between 20KB and 50KB.
  • Ensure the scanned image is no larger than 1024KB. If it exceeds this size, adjust scanner settings such as DPI resolution and color depth during scanning.

Signature Image

  • The applicant must sign on white paper using a black ink pen.
  • The signature must be done only by the applicant.
  • The signature will appear on the ADMIT CARD and where necessary.
  • The signature on the ADMIT CARD and the attendance sheet during the exam must match the uploaded signature. Any mismatch may result in disqualification.
  • Preferred dimensions: 140 x 60 pixels.
  • File size should be between 10KB and 20KB.
  • Ensure the scanned image size is no more than 20KB.
